OceanBase 代碼片段

2021-06-30 09:47 更新

OceanBase 開發(fā)者中心(OceanBase Developer Center,ODC)作為企業(yè)級數(shù)據(jù)庫開發(fā)平臺,為您提供代碼片段模塊以方便您在 ODC 中進行數(shù)據(jù)庫開發(fā)工作。當(dāng)您在開發(fā)過程中遺忘了一些語句的具體用法時,可以直接在 ODC 提供的代碼片段模塊中進行查詢。代碼片段模塊會根據(jù)您當(dāng)前連接的數(shù)據(jù)庫模式(Oracle 或 MySQL)提供對應(yīng)的代碼片段。除了內(nèi)置的代碼片段外,您還可以自定義代碼片段以記錄您常用的代碼方便下次使用,自定義的代碼片段僅可被創(chuàng)建者查看。

在 SQL 窗口、匿名塊窗口和 PL 對象編輯頁面的工具欄中,單擊 代碼片段 按鈕彈出代碼片段面板。 OceanBase代碼片段

查看代碼片段

在代碼片段面板中以卡片列表的形式展示代碼片段,每個卡片上直接展示了代碼片段名稱、代碼片段描述和代碼片段類型等信息。將鼠標(biāo)放置在卡片代碼片段名稱后的提示圖標(biāo)上,會浮現(xiàn)提示窗展示目標(biāo)代碼片段的全部代碼信息。

在卡片列表的上方 ODC 提供了搜索框,您可以借助搜索功能直接查找具體的代碼片段。在搜索框的下方提供按類型進行篩選的篩選器。篩選器中默認(rèn)選中全部類型,您可以單擊篩選器選擇篩選出 常規(guī)、DML、DDL、流程控制語句 和 全部類型 的代碼片段。

新建代碼片段

在代碼片段列表的右上角,單擊 +新建 按鈕彈出 新建代碼片段 面板。在面板中需指定以下信息:

  • 代碼片段名稱:指定代碼片段的名稱。名稱可由英文字母、數(shù)字和下劃線組成,長度不超過 60 字符,必填項。

  • 代碼片段類型:選擇代碼的類型。支持選擇 常規(guī)DML、DDL 和 流程控制語句 等類型,默認(rèn)為 常規(guī) 類型。

  • 代碼片段:在 代碼片段 標(biāo)簽下的編輯框中輸入代碼片段的具體代碼內(nèi)容,長度不能超過 200 字符,必填項。與 SQL 窗口類似,編輯區(qū)的工具欄中還提供了格式化、查找/替換、撤銷、重做、大小寫、縮進和注釋等工具,且提供代碼高亮和聯(lián)想等功能。

  • 代碼片段描述:對代碼片段內(nèi)容的補充說明,長度不能超過 200 字符,必填項。

OceanBase代碼片段

引用代碼片段

創(chuàng)建好的代碼片段除了供您在編輯腳本的時候查看代碼的具體內(nèi)容外,還支持直接將內(nèi)容直接引用進腳本。引用代碼片段有以下三種方法:

  • 方法一:您可以直接將列表中的卡片拖拽進編輯區(qū)中,該代碼片段指定的代碼內(nèi)容將被粘貼進編輯區(qū)。

  • 方法二:在目標(biāo)代碼片段的卡片上,單擊卡片右下角的復(fù)制圖標(biāo)以復(fù)制代碼內(nèi)容,在編輯區(qū)中通過快捷鍵 Ctrl+V 或 Cmd + V 將代碼內(nèi)容粘貼進編輯區(qū)。

  • 方法三:SQL 窗口的編輯區(qū)支持代碼聯(lián)想功能,當(dāng)您在編輯區(qū)中編輯腳本時,創(chuàng)建好的代碼片段會出現(xiàn)在代碼聯(lián)想的提示窗中,您可以通過代碼聯(lián)想的提示查看和引用代碼片段。

管理代碼片段

自定義的代碼片段提供 編輯 和 刪除 兩個管理操作,您無法對內(nèi)置的代碼片段進行管理。

  • 編輯:單擊目標(biāo)代碼卡片右上角的管理圖標(biāo)(···)在彈出的列表中單擊 編輯 按鈕進入 編輯代碼片段 面板。面板中展示新建代碼片段時指定的 代碼片段名稱代碼片段類型、代碼片段 和 代碼片段描述 等信息,您可以按需進行修改。

  • 刪除:單擊目標(biāo)代碼卡片右上角的管理圖標(biāo)(···)在彈出的列表中單擊 刪除 按鈕以刪除當(dāng)前代碼片段。


以上內(nèi)容是否對您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號
微信公眾號

編程獅公眾號